Stafi (FIS) Cryptocurrency Market Data and Information

What is Stafi (FIS)?

Stafi, short for Staking Finance, is a decentralized finance (DeFi) protocol designed to unlock the liquidity of staked assets. It addresses the problem that arises when users stake their tokens in Proof-of-Stake (PoS) networks, effectively locking those assets and preventing them from being used in other DeFi applications. Stafi allows users to stake their PoS tokens and receive rTokens (reward tokens) in return, which are tradable representations of their staked assets, all the while the user continues to accrue staking rewards.

FIS is the native cryptocurrency token of the Stafi Chain and is integral to the platform’s operation. It serves multiple crucial functions within the Stafi ecosystem. Similar to DOT’s role in Polkadot, FIS is fundamental for maintaining system integrity and capturing value.

The Stafi project was co-founded by Liam Young and Tore Zhang. Their vision was to create a platform that seamlessly interoperates, enabling users to engage in DeFi across various blockchains with ease. Stafi aims to provide secure and efficient rToken solutions to optimize cross-chain transactions.

How Does Stafi (FIS) Work?

Stafi operates by allowing users to stake their native tokens of various PoS blockchains through its platform. In exchange, users receive rTokens, which represent their staked assets on a 1:1 basis. These rTokens are synthetic assets that unlock the liquidity of the staked tokens while still allowing the user to earn staking rewards. This allows users to participate in the DeFi ecosystem without sacrificing the returns from staking.

The Stafi protocol is built on the Stafi Chain, which utilizes the Substrate framework from Polkadot. This allows it to easily integrate with other blockchains and DeFi platforms. The Substrate framework provides a modular and flexible architecture, enabling Stafi to adapt to changing market conditions and technological advancements. Furthermore, FIS token holders can participate in on-chain governance, influencing the project’s direction and participating in value generation through rToken solutions.

The process typically involves a user depositing their PoS tokens into a Stafi smart contract. The smart contract then stakes these tokens on the native PoS blockchain. The protocol mints an equivalent amount of rTokens, providing the user with liquid representations of their staked assets.

BAI Stablecoin (BAI) Cryptocurrency Market Data and Information

What is BAI Stablecoin?

BAI Stablecoin (BAI) is a decentralized, multi-collateral stablecoin designed to maintain a hard peg to the US dollar. It operates within the Polkadot ecosystem, specifically built on the Astar Network. The primary aim of BAI is to provide a stable and reliable digital currency for use in decentralized finance (DeFi) applications.

Developed by AstridDAO, BAI enables users to borrow the stablecoin against a range of crypto assets. These assets include $ASTR, $BTC, $ETH, and $DOT, allowing holders to unlock the value of their holdings without selling them. This provides increased capital efficiency and opportunities for users within the Polkadot ecosystem.

BAI aims to be a crucial building block for DeFi on Astar Network. By offering a stable and readily accessible stablecoin, BAI hopes to foster innovation and growth within the Polkadot ecosystem. Its design focuses on security and accessibility, attempting to provide a reliable and trustworthy digital currency.

How Does BAI Work?

BAI operates as a multi-collateral stablecoin, meaning it is backed by a basket of different cryptocurrencies. Users can deposit supported assets into the AstridDAO protocol as collateral. In return, they can borrow BAI up to a certain collateralization ratio, depending on the asset deposited.

A core element of BAI’s function is its 0% interest borrowing mechanism. Users can borrow BAI without incurring interest charges, making it an attractive option for those seeking to leverage their crypto holdings. This is achieved through a combination of liquidation mechanisms and the stability fees built into the AstridDAO system.

The AstridDAO protocol incorporates liquidation protocols to maintain BAI’s peg to the US dollar. If a user’s collateral falls below the required ratio, their position may be liquidated to ensure the system remains solvent. This helps ensure BAI remains stable and pegged to the US dollar.

Quickswap [OLD] (QUICK) Cryptocurrency Market Data and Information

What is Quickswap (OLD)?

Quickswap (OLD), also known as QUICK, represents the original iteration of the native token for the QuickSwap decentralized exchange (DEX). This DEX operates primarily on the Polygon Proof-of-Stake (PoS) network, Polygon zkEVM, and Dogechain. It gained popularity for its quick transaction processing and minimal gas fees, enhancing user experience within the decentralized finance (DeFi) space.

The QuickSwap DEX launched in 2020, and has provided users with a broad spectrum of DeFi functionalities. These features include token swaps, opportunities to contribute liquidity to pools, yield farming incentives, and staking mechanisms. These components collectively foster a comprehensive ecosystem for users to engage with various aspects of DeFi.

It is important to note that in 2022, QuickSwap underwent a token split, re-denominating its QUICK token to a “New QUICK” at a ratio of 1:1000. The original “Old QUICK” token no longer possesses utility within the QuickSwap exchange. Users holding Old QUICK can convert their tokens to the new version via a dedicated converter on the QuickSwap platform.

How Does Quickswap (OLD) Work?

The operational model of QuickSwap (OLD) is historically tied to the core functions of the QuickSwap decentralized exchange. Functioning as an Automated Market Maker (AMM), QuickSwap relies on liquidity pools rather than traditional order books to facilitate trading. Users deposit tokens into these pools, providing liquidity for others to swap between different cryptocurrencies.

The price of tokens within the pool is determined by an algorithm that considers the ratio of tokens in the pool. When a trade occurs, a small fee is charged, which is then distributed to the liquidity providers as a reward. This incentivizes users to provide liquidity, ensuring the smooth operation of the exchange.

While Old QUICK has no utility, originally, the QUICK token played a vital role in the QuickSwap ecosystem. The token was designed to incentivize participation and provide governance rights to its holders. Now, the new token does this.

Star Atlas (ATLAS) Cryptocurrency Market Data and Information

What is Star Atlas (ATLAS)?

Star Atlas (ATLAS) is a next-generation blockchain-based metaverse set in a vast, space-themed environment. It combines cutting-edge blockchain technology, real-time graphics, and multiplayer video game elements. The game is built on the Solana blockchain and set in the year 2620, offering players an immersive and expansive universe.

Players can explore space, engage in territorial conquest, and participate in a decentralized, player-driven economy. The combination of Unreal Engine 5’s Nanite technology with blockchain ensures cinematic quality visuals and a secure, largely serverless gameplay experience. This creates an environment where non-fungible tokens (NFTs) represent in-game assets, fostering a digital economy that mirrors real-world ownership.

Star Atlas aims to deliver a deeply engaging metaverse experience. It allows players to own, trade, and utilize digital assets within the game, blurring the lines between the digital and physical worlds. The project is developed by Automata, which focuses on blending blockchain with AAA gaming experiences to create an immersive metaverse.

How Does Star Atlas (ATLAS) Work?

Star Atlas operates on the Solana blockchain, which provides the speed and scalability needed for a complex metaverse. This allows for fast transactions and low fees, essential for a vibrant in-game economy. The game leverages NFTs to represent various in-game assets, such as spaceships, land, and resources.

Players can acquire these NFTs through gameplay or by purchasing them on the in-game marketplace. These assets can be used to explore, mine resources, engage in combat, and build their presence within the Star Atlas universe. The game employs a dual-token system consisting of ATLAS and POLIS.

ATLAS serves as the primary in-game currency, used for transactions within the game. POLIS, on the other hand, is the governance token that allows players to participate in the decision-making processes of the game. This decentralized governance model ensures that the community has a say in the future direction of the Star Atlas metaverse.
